SUMMARY

In Microsoft Excel, you can create a Microsoft Visual Basic for Applications macro (Sub procedure) to select every nth row within a currently selected contiguous range on a worksheet. An example of such a procedure is provided below.

Sample Visual Basic Procedure

  Sub SelectEveryNthRow()

       ' Initialize ColsSelection equal to the number of columns in the
       ' selection.
       ColsSelection = Selection.Columns.Count

       ' Initialize RowsSelection equal to the number of rows in your
       ' selection.
       RowsSelection = Selection.Rows.Count

       ' Initialize RowsBetween equal to three.
       RowsBetween = 3

       ' Initialize Diff equal to one row less than the first row number of
       ' the selection.
       Diff = Selection.Row - 1

       ' Resize the selection to be 1 column wide and the same number of
       ' rows long as the initial selection.
       Selection.Resize(RowsSelection, 1).Select

       ' Resize the selection to be every third row and the same number of
       ' columns wide as the original selection.
       Set FinalRange = Selection. _
          Offset(RowsBetween - 1, 0).Resize(1,ColsSelection)

       ' Loop through each cell in the selection.
       For Each xCell In Selection

           ' If the row number is a multiple of 3, then . . .
           If xCell.Row Mod RowsBetween = Diff Then
               ' ...reset FinalRange to include the union of the current
               ' FinalRange and the same number of columns.
               Set FinalRange = Application.Union _
                   (FinalRange, xCell.Resize(1,ColsSelection))
           ' End check.
           End If
       ' Iterate loop.
       Next xCell
       ' Select the requested cells in the range.
       FinalRange.Select
   End Sub
